Based on the Bally table from 1980.      
Thanks to Carlos Guizzo for the images of the real table.
Playfield and plastics redrawn by me in full glorious 4k :)
 
This version 4 of the table needed some extra work :)
 
There are three player options at the top of script. You don't need to change them, but if you prefer a closer version to the real table then you may set those options to False.
The options are all set to True, and they are:
 
Const Digits7 = True       'set it to False if you prefer 6 digits as the original machine
Const FlipperPeg = True    'set it to False if you do not want the ball saver peg
Const FlippersDecor = True 'set it to False if you do not want decorations on the flippers
 
The rom names are:
"ngndshkb"  7 Digit ROM
"ngndshkr"  6 Digit ROM - original
 
And remember to press F6 to set the ROM options, at least you need the Match Feature and the Credits display visible.
